Blackview BV6800 Pro vs Ulefone S7 1/8Gb: Antutu benchmark comparison.
Blackview BV6800 Pro in the AnTuTu benchmark test got 44112 score points which is 95.56% faster than the Ulefone S7 1/8Gb, which got 22557. You can compare its ranking and performance with other models results based on the Antutu test below.
Blackview BV6800 Pro vs Ulefone S7 1/8Gb: Geekbench benchmark comparison.
Blackview BV6800 Pro in the Geekbench benchmark tests got a 123 points score in "Single-core" of against the Ulefone S7 1/8Gb which got 71, it is 73.24% faster. In "Multi-core" score 632 vs 248 (154.84% faster). You can compare its ranking and performance with other models results based on the Geekbench test below.
What is the difference between Blackview BV6800 Pro and Ulefone S7 1/8Gb? (compare specs) (which is better)
The main differences, why it is better to choose the Blackview BV6800 Pro (advantages)
- Good performance: Is 95.56% faster in the Antutu test (21555 score difference).
- Has a higher resolution newer rear camera: 16Mp compared to 8Mp
- Has a higher resolution front (selfie) camera: 8Mp vs 5Mp .
- NFC supports.
- Has a higher screen resolution: 2160x1080 vs 1280x720.
- More battery capacity: 6580mAh vs 2500mAh (a difference of 4080mAh).
- Have water resistant supports.
- Have wireless charging supports.
- Have fast charging supports.
